Newcastle's Pigs Pigs Pigs Pigs Pigs Pigs Pigs are back with a new single and an unexpected but fantastic collaboration. "Glib Tongued" is a giant, riff heavy track that features a guest verse from El-P of Run the Jewels and Company Flow. It's a mid-tempo track that grinds it's way through four minutes of sludge. It's reminding me of Clutch meets Black Sabbath, but in a way that a rap verse makes perfect sense. It starts off with a whining feedback guitar and a killer bass line, and keeps going from there. We don't bring you a ton of heavy stuff here at If It's Too Loud..., but a song as great as "Glib Tongued" is irresistible.
Bassist John-Michael Hedley says of the band's latest single:
"Glib Tongued was an idea I’d been sitting on for a few years. It felt like the right time to inject it into 'Death Hilarious'. Though after bringing it to the table it morphed into something bigger and better than I could have ever imagined. Securing El-P’s services for a verse blew my mind and I feel immensely proud that an idea I’d worked on during an extremely dark time in my life, has flourished into a powerful force for good. I hope."
